      A BILL ENTITLED
 
AN ORDINANCE concerning
title
Baltimore City Landmark List - Equitable Building
 
FOR the purpose of designating the Equitable Building, 10-12 North Calvert Street, as a historical landmark.
body
 
BY adding
  Article 6 - Historical and Architectural Preservation
  Section(s) 13-10
  Baltimore City Code
   (Edition 2000)
 
  SECTION 1.  BE IT ORDAINED BY THE MAYOR AND CITY COUNCIL OF BALTIMORE, That the Laws of Baltimore City read as follows:
 
      Baltimore City Code
 
      Article 6.  Historical and Architectural Preservation
 
      Subtitle 13.  Landmark List - 2010s
 
ยง 13-10.  EQUITABLE BUILDING.
 
  EQUITABLE BUILDING, 10-12 NORTH CALVERT STREET.
 
  SECTION 2.  AND BE IT FURTHER ORDAINED, That the catchlines contained in this Ordinance are not law and may not be considered to have been enacted as a part of this or any prior Ordinance.
 
  SECTION 3.  AND BE IT FURTHER ORDAINED, That this Ordinance takes effect on the 30th day after the date it is enacted.
